School scale

1,324 students

Prairie Point reports 1,324 students, larger than most same-level county peers. Among 17 other middle schools in Linn County with enrollment data, 17 report fewer students and 0 report more. The peer median is 526 students.

County peer set

18 middle schools

The same-level county median enrollment is 532 students. Use it to separate unusually small or large schools from typical peers.

District path

10 district schools

College Comm School District lists 5 primary, 2 middle, 1 high, 2 other schools in the current NCES data. For a middle-school choice, confirm which high school students usually continue to and whether program eligibility changes by address.
